Rapid Determination of Hydrogen Peroxide in Milk with Non‐enzymatic Amperometric Sensor Based on Porous Gold Modified Screen‐printed Electrode in Online Dialysis System

Abstract: A rapid method for determination of hydrogen peroxide based on a non‐enzymatic amperometric sensor with an online dialysis unit was developed for analysis of sample with complicated matrices. A porous gold modified gold screen‐printed electrode was prepared by a simple method using 9 V‐battery electrodeposition. Based on data from amperometry, a linear dynamic range can be obtained in the range of 10 to 1000 μmol L−1, with a limit of detection of 0.37 μmol L−1.
